async supplyData(this: IExecuteFunctions, itemIndex: number): Promise<SupplyData> {
const name = this.getNodeParameter('name', itemIndex) as string;
const description = this.getNodeParameter('description', itemIndex) as string;
const runFunction = async (query: string): Promise<string> => {
const source = this.getNodeParameter('source', itemIndex) as string;
const responsePropertyName = this.getNodeParameter(
'responsePropertyName',
itemIndex,
) as string;
const workflowInfo: IExecuteWorkflowInfo = {};
if (source === 'database') {
// Read workflow from database
workflowInfo.id = this.getNodeParameter('workflowId', itemIndex) as string;
} else if (source === 'parameter') {
// Read workflow from parameter
const workflowJson = this.getNodeParameter('workflowJson', itemIndex) as string;
try {
workflowInfo.code = JSON.parse(workflowJson) as IWorkflowBase;
} catch (error) {
throw new NodeOperationError(
this.getNode(),
`The provided workflow is not valid JSON: "${(error as Error).message}"`,
{
itemIndex,
},
);
}
}
const rawData: IDataObject = { query };
const workflowFieldsJson = this.getNodeParameter('fields.values', itemIndex, [], {
rawExpressions: true,
}) as SetField[];
// Copied from Set Node v2
for (const entry of workflowFieldsJson) {
if (entry.type === 'objectValue' && (entry.objectValue as string).startsWith('=')) {
rawData[entry.name] = (entry.objectValue as string).replace(/^=+/, '');
}
}
const options: SetNodeOptions = {
include: 'all',
};
const newItem = await manual.execute.call(
this,
{ json: { query } },
itemIndex,
options,
rawData,
this.getNode(),
);
const items = [newItem] as INodeExecutionData[];
let receivedData: INodeExecutionData;
try {
receivedData = (await this.executeWorkflow(workflowInfo, items)) as INodeExecutionData;
} catch (error) {
// Make sure a valid error gets returned that can by json-serialized else it will
// not show up in the frontend
throw new NodeOperationError(this.getNode(), error as Error);
}
const response: string | undefined = get(receivedData, [
0,
0,
'json',
responsePropertyName,
]) as string | undefined;
if (response === undefined) {
throw new NodeOperationError(
this.getNode(),
`There was an error: "The workflow did not return an item with the property '${responsePropertyName}'"`,
);
}
return response;
};
return {
response: new DynamicTool({
name,
description,
func: async (query: string): Promise<string> => {
const { index } = this.addInputData(NodeConnectionType.AiTool, [[{ json: { query } }]]);
let response: string = '';
let executionError: ExecutionError | undefined;
try {
response = await runFunction(query);
} catch (error) {
// TODO: Do some more testing. Issues here should actually fail the workflow
// eslint-disable-next-line @typescript-eslint/no-unsafe-assignment
executionError = error;
// eslint-disable-next-line @typescript-eslint/no-unsafe-member-access
response = `There was an error: "${error.message}"`;
}
if (typeof response === 'number') {
response = (response as number).toString();
}
if (isObject(response)) {
response = JSON.stringify(response, null, 2);
}
if (typeof response !== 'string') {
// TODO: Do some more testing. Issues here should actually fail the workflow
executionError = new NodeOperationError(
this.getNode(),
`The code did not return a valid value. Instead of a string did a value of type '${typeof response}' get returned.`,
);
response = `There was an error: "${executionError.message}"`;
}
if (executionError) {
void this.addOutputData(NodeConnectionType.AiTool, index, executionError);
} else {
void this.addOutputData(NodeConnectionType.AiTool, index, [[{ json: { response } }]]);
}
return response;
},
}),
};
}
}
